Order-picking systems and methods
The order-picking process is the most laborious and the most costly activity in a typical warehouse. As 50% of total order picking time is spent on traveling, organizational changes and application of various order-picking methods to reduce travel distances could lead to significant improvements. In this paper routing, storage and orderbatching methods are analyzed by simulation. The presented results showed up to 80% possible reduction of travel distances using appropriate combination of orderpicking methods.
